Thai Eatery Little Uncle Now Open

Little Uncle, the Thai pop-up shop that used to be known as Shophouse, opens its doors today from 11 am to 2 pm at its new East Madison home, per its Facebook page. Poncharee Kounpungchart and Wiley Frank are offering up items such as Pad Thai without noodles($8) and Pad Thai($8), and Sala Bao(braised beef cheeks bun) for $3. Cash only for now.

Wiley Frank began this pop-up shop, when he was still working at Lark. He and his wife, Poncharee Kounpungchart, initially held the Shophouse dinners on Monday nights at neighboring Licorous, before moving them to La Bete on Mondays. Seattle Magazine recently named Little Uncle, "Best Pop-Up Restaurant" of 2011.
